परिचय:
डेटा फ्लो डायग्राम (DFDs) एक प्रणाली के माध्यम से जानकारी के आवागमन को दृश्य रूप से दिखाने के लिए शक्तिशाली उपकरण के रूप में कार्य करते हैं। हालांकि, इनके पूर्ण संभावना का उपयोग करने के लिए, संतुलन के कला को सीखना आवश्यक है। संतुलन सुनिश्चित करता है कि DFDs प्रत्येक स्तर के अमूर्तता पर संगत, सटीक और आसानी से समझे जाने वाले रहें। इस व्यापक गाइड में, हम आपको डेटा प्रवाह के समन्वित और अच्छी तरह से संगठित प्रतिनिधित्व को प्राप्त करने के लिए चरण-दर-चरण प्रक्रिया के मार्गदर्शन करेंगे।
डेटा फ्लो डायग्राम (DFD) में संतुलन का मुख्य उद्देश्य विभिन्न स्तरों के डायग्रामों के बीच संगतता और स्पष्टता बनाए रखना है। संतुलन का उद्देश्य यह सुनिश्चित करना है कि सूचना और डेटा प्रवाह प्रणाली के प्रतिनिधित्व के दौरान सटीक, पूर्ण और अच्छी तरह से संगठित रहे।
जब आप एक उच्च स्तर की प्रक्रिया को निम्न स्तर के डायग्राम में विस्तारित करते हैं, तो आपको यह सुनिश्चित करना होगा कि उच्च स्तर की प्रक्रिया के सभी इनपुट और आउटपुट को निम्न स्तर के डायग्राम में सही तरीके से प्रतिबिंबित किया जाए। इसका अर्थ है कि उच्च स्तर पर प्रक्रिया के प्रत्येक इनपुट को निम्न स्तर पर उसी प्रक्रिया के इनपुट के रूप में होना चाहिए, और आउटपुट के लिए भी यही लागू होता है।
यहाँ संतुलन के महत्व के कारण हैं:
- संगतता: यह सुनिश्चित करता है कि डायग्राम के विभिन्न स्तरों पर प्रस्तुत सूचना संगत हो। उपयोगकर्ता को उच्चतम स्तर (संदर्भ डायग्राम) से निम्नतम स्तर तक इनपुट और आउटपुट का निरंतर ट्रेस करने में सक्षम होना चाहिए।
- पूर्णता: यह डेटा प्रतिनिधित्व में पूर्णता बनाए रखने में मदद करता है। प्रत्येक ऐसी जानकारी जो किसी प्रक्रिया में प्रवेश करती है या उससे बाहर जाती है, को प्रत्येक अमूर्तता के स्तर पर ध्यान में रखा जाना चाहिए।
- सटीकता: संतुलन डेटा प्रवाह प्रतिनिधित्व की सटीकता सुनिश्चित करता है। यदि डिजाइन या विश्लेषण चरण के दौरान कोई नया इनपुट या आउटपुट पहचाना जाता है, तो उसे सटीकता बनाए रखने के लिए सभी संबंधित स्तरों पर व्यवस्थित रूप से जोड़ा जाना चाहिए।
- ट्रेसेबिलिटी: यह डेटा प्रवाह की ट्रेसेबिलिटी को सुगम बनाता है। यह समझने के लिए आवश्यक है कि डेटा प्रणाली के माध्यम से कैसे आगे बढ़ता है और किसी भी असंगति या गायब तत्व की पहचान करने के लिए।
- समझने में आसानी: संतुलित डायग्राम समझने और व्याख्या करने में आसान होते हैं। वे डेटा के प्रणाली के माध्यम से आगे बढ़ने के तरीके का स्पष्ट और संगठित दृश्य प्रदान करते हैं बिना किसी अस्पष्टता के।
DFD में संतुलन एक ऐसी प्रथा है जो डायग्रामों की अखंडता और स्पष्टता सुनिश्चित करती है, जिससे वे प्रणाली के भीतर सूचना के प्रवाह को समझने और संचारित करने के लिए प्रभावी उपकरण बन जाते हैं। यह बदलाव करने में लचीलापन प्रदान करता है जबकि डेटा प्रवाह के संरचित और एक-दूसरे से जुड़े प्रतिनिधित्व को बनाए रखता है।
10 चरणों में डेटा फ्लो डायग्राम का संतुलन करना
चरण 1: संदर्भ डायग्राम विकसित करें
पहले एक संदर्भ डायग्राम बनाएं जो पूरी प्रणाली का उच्च स्तर का अवलोकन प्रदान करे। मुख्य प्रक्रियाओं और शामिल बाहरी एकाइयों की पहचान करें।
चरण 2: स्तर 1 डायग्राम में विस्तारित करें
संदर्भ डायग्राम में पहचाने गए प्रत्येक प्रक्रिया के लिए संबंधित स्तर 1 डायग्राम बनाएं। प्रत्येक प्रक्रिया के इनपुट और आउटपुट को परिभाषित करें, और यह सुनिश्चित करें कि वे संदर्भ डायग्राम के साथ संगत हों।
चरण 3: इनपुट-आउटपुट संगतता बनाए रखें
जब एक प्रक्रिया को उच्च स्तर से निम्न स्तर पर विस्तारित करते हैं, तो उच्च स्तर पर सभी इनपुट और आउटपुट को निम्न स्तर पर सही तरीके से प्रतिबिंबित किया जाना चाहिए। कोई भी अतिरिक्त इनपुट या आउटपुट तभी जोड़े जाने चाहिए जब वे निम्न स्तर की प्रक्रिया का हिस्सा हों।
चरण 4: पूर्णता की जांच करें
सुनिश्चित करें कि संदर्भ डायग्राम में मौजूद सभी इनपुट और आउटपुट को स्तर 1 डायग्राम में ध्यान में रखा गया है। प्रणाली में प्रवेश करने या उससे बाहर जाने वाला प्रत्येक डेटा प्रवाह को विस्तृत डायग्राम में शामिल किया जाना चाहिए।
चरण 5: आवश्यक संशोधनों की अनुमति दें
यह स्वीकार करें कि डिजाइन चरण के दौरान समायोजन की आवश्यकता हो सकती है। यदि कोई नया इनपुट या आउटपुट पहचाना जाता है, तो उसे निम्न स्तर पर संबंधित प्रक्रिया में जोड़ें। सुनिश्चित करें कि इस संशोधन को सभी उच्च स्तर के डायग्राम में प्रतिबिंबित किया गया है।
चरण 6: आवर्ती संतुलन
संतुलन एक आवर्ती प्रक्रिया है। जैसे-जैसे आप अब्स्ट्रैक्शन के निम्न स्तर पर जाते हैं, निरंतर आरेखों की जांच करें और संतुलित करें। यह सुनिश्चित करें कि डेटा प्रवाह सही ढंग से प्रतिबिंबित किए गए हैं, और आवश्यकता होने पर समायोजन करें।
चरण 7: परिवर्तनों का दस्तावेजीकरण
संतुलन प्रक्रिया के दौरान किए गए किसी भी परिवर्तन को स्पष्ट रूप से दस्तावेजीकृत करें। परिवर्तनों के कारणों को नोट करें, चाहे वह एक नए डेटा प्रवाह के जोड़ने के कारण हो या प्राचीन डेटा प्रवाह के हटाने के कारण हो। इस दस्तावेजीकरण से सिस्टम प्रतिनिधित्व के विकास को समझने में सहायता मिलती है।
चरण 8: प्रमाणीकरण और समीक्षा
नियमित रूप से संतुलित आरेखों की स्टेकहोल्डर्स और टीम सदस्यों के साथ प्रमाणीकरण और समीक्षा करें। इससे यह सुनिश्चित होता है कि सभी को सिस्टम के डेटा प्रवाह के बारे में साझा समझ हो और किसी भी अंतर या गलतफहमी की पहचान करने में मदद मिलती है।
चरण 9: ट्रेसेबिलिटी सुनिश्चित करें
आरेखों के पूरे दौरान ट्रेसेबिलिटी बनाए रखें। उपयोगकर्ताओं को संदर्भ आरेख से न्यूनतम स्तर तक डेटा प्रवाह का अनुसरण करने में कोई भ्रम नहीं होना चाहिए। ट्रेसेबिलिटी सिस्टम प्रतिनिधित्व की स्पष्टता को बढ़ाती है।
चरण 10: अंतिम रूप दें और प्रकाशित करें
जब संतुलन प्रक्रिया पूरी हो जाए, तो आरेखों को अंतिम रूप दें और उन्हें सिस्टम दस्तावेजीकरण के हिस्से के रूप में प्रकाशित करें। ये संतुलित DFD सिस्टम विश्लेषण, डिजाइन और संचार के लिए मूल्यवान उपकरण के रूप में कार्य करते हैं।
इन चरणों का पालन करके सॉफ्टवेयर इंजीनियर और सिस्टम विश्लेषक यह सुनिश्चित कर सकते हैं कि उनके डेटा प्रवाह आरेख संतुलित, सटीक हैं और डेटा के सिस्टम के माध्यम से गति के बारे में व्यापक प्रतिनिधित्व प्रदान करते हैं।
सारांश
डेटा प्रवाह आरेखों का संतुलन एक व्यवस्थित और आवर्ती प्रक्रिया है जो संदर्भ आरेख के विकास से शुरू होती है और विस्तृत स्तर 1 आरेखों तक फैलती है। इस चरण-दर-चरण गाइड में इनपुट-आउटपुट संगतता बनाए रखने, पूर्णता की जांच करने और डिजाइन चरण के दौरान आवश्यक संशोधनों की अनुमति देने के महत्व पर जोर दिया गया है। संतुलन की आवर्ती प्रकृति सुनिश्चित करती है कि परिवर्तनों का दस्तावेजीकरण किया गया है, प्रमाणीकरण किया गया है और समीक्षा किया गया है, जिससे स्पष्टता, सटीकता और ट्रेसेबिलिटी वाले अंतिम DFD सेट प्राप्त होते हैं। चाहे आप सॉफ्टवेयर इंजीनियर, सिस्टम विश्लेषक या स्टेकहोल्डर हों, DFD संतुलन के नियंत्रण से आपकी सिस्टम के भीतर जानकारी के प्रवाह को समझने, संचार करने और कुशल डिजाइन करने की क्षमता बढ़ती है।
विजुअल पैराडाइम का उपयोग में आसान डेटा प्रवाह आरेख संपादक
परिचय:
डेटा प्रवाह आरेखों (DFDs) के साथ अपने सिस्टम के भीतर जानकारी के प्रवाह को दृश्य रूप से देखने की शक्ति को खोलें।विजुअल पैराडाइमएक उपयोगकर्ता-अनुकूल DFD संपादक प्रस्तुत करता है जो निर्माण प्रक्रिया को सरल बनाता है, जिससे आप अपने सिस्टम के माध्यम से जानकारी के गति को आसानी से नक्शा बना सकते हैं। चाहे आप इनपुट और आउटपुट की पहचान कर रहे हों या किसी विशिष्ट प्रक्रिया के लिए आवश्यक जानकारी को निर्दिष्ट कर रहे हों, हमारा संपादक एक निरंतर अनुभव प्रदान करता है।

मुख्य विशेषताएं:
- खींचकर छोड़कर आकृति निर्माण:एक स्पष्ट ड्रैग-एंड-ड्रॉप इंटरफेस के साथ आसानी से अपने DFD का निर्माण करें। आप बिना किसी कठिनाई के प्रक्रियाओं, एकाधिकारों और डेटा प्रवाहों को जोड़ सकते हैं ताकि आपके सिस्टम का व्यापक प्रतिनिधित्व बन सके।
- सटीक आकृति स्थिति:संरेखण गाइड के साथ पिक्सेल-परफेक्ट सटीकता प्राप्त करें। तत्वों को ठीक वहां स्थित करें जहां आप चाहते हैं, ताकि आरेख साफ और व्यवस्थित रहे।
- तत्व पुनर्उपयोगता:अपने आरेखों में तत्वों के पुनर्उपयोग से समय बचाएं और स्थिरता बनाए रखें। बिना फिर से शुरू किए बार-बार आने वाली प्रक्रियाओं या एकाधिकारों का प्रतिनिधित्व करें।
- मॉडलिंग सरलता:विजुअल पैराडाइम मॉडलिंग प्रक्रिया को सरल बनाता है, जिससे शुरुआती और अनुभवी विशेषज्ञ दोनों के लिए उपलब्ध होता है। एक तीव्र शिक्षा वक्र के बिना त्वरित और सटीक DFD बनाएं।
विजुअल पैराडाइम क्यों?
हमारा DFD संपादक सिस्टम डिजाइनर, विश्लेषक और स्टेकहोल्डर्स की विविध आवश्यकताओं को पूरा करने के लिए डिज़ाइन किया गया है। चाहे आप एक नए सिस्टम की अवधारणा बना रहे हों या मौजूदा सिस्टम को बेहतर बना रहे हों, विजुअल पैराडाइम का संपादक आपको बिना किसी दिक्कत के मॉडलिंग अनुभव के लिए एक शक्तिशाली सेट विशेषताओं के साथ सशक्त बनाता है।
विजुअल पैराडाइम के उपयोग में आसान डेटा प्रवाह आरेख संपादक के साथ अपने विचारों को दृश्य प्रतिनिधित्व में बदलें – जहां सरलता और सूक्ष्मता मिलती है।












